Who can the DOT exam be administered to? - ANSWER-Anyone who requests the exam, regardless of age 
 
Who is responsible for ensuring the driver meets the minimum age requirement of 21 years old? - ANSWER-Motor carrier 
 
When should a BP be confirmed with a second measurement during the exam? - ANSWER-Any BP 140/90 or greater 
 
What BP readings may be used for certification decisions? - ANSWER-Only BP readings taken during the DOT physical exam

5 Feet - ANSWER-A CMV driver must perceive a forced whispered voice in the better eat at not less than ___ with or w/o a hearing aid 
 
Audiogram - ANSWER-This test is performed only when the Forced Whisper Test is failed in both ears 
 
40 decibels - ANSWER-If tested by the use of an audiometric device, they must not have an AVERAGE hearing loss in the better ear greater than ____ at 500Hz, 1000Hz, and 2000Hz
